FKF Premier League: Tusker win to dislodge champions Gor Mahia

Tusker reclaimed second spot in the Football Kenya Federation (FKF) Premier League table following a 2-0 win against Murang’a Seal at Machakos Stadium on Saturday.

The Brewers went into the fixture knowing that with Gor Mahia not playing on Sunday – their Mashemeji derby against AFC Leopards called off – a win would enable them to leapfrog K’Ogalo and settle in second position on the 16-team league table.

They took the lead in the 12th minute when Dennis Oguta did well to flick behind a looped ball from George Kaddu. The ball found Deogratious Ojok, who took it in his stride, and powered past three markers before firing home.

In the 26th minute, it should have been 2-0 to the Brewers after Oguta was brought down outside the box. Left-back Dennis ‘Decha’ Wanjala stood behind the long-range free-kick, but his effort flew over the bar. Two minutes later, ‘Decha’ delivered a brilliant cross from the left. Oguta met it with a nifty touch, but the keeper dived to bat it away for a fruitless corner.

At the start of the second half, substitute Eric Belecho picked up the ball on the turn and fired into the net to double Tusker’s lead. Murang’a had a chance to reduce the deficit in the 60th minute when they were awarded a penalty, but Joe Waithira sent his effort wide.

The win enabled Tusker to move second with 55 points. They are now three points behind leaders Kenya Police, and two points ahead of Gor Mahia. Tusker have managed 16 wins, 10 draws and suffered four defeats this season.
